A Taste of Tradition
Mexican cuisine is a harmonious blend of indigenous ingredients and Spanish influences, resulting in a delightful array of dishes that cater to various palates. Here are some Mexican food staples you should definitely try:
Tacos
Tacos are undoubtedly one of Mexico’s most iconic culinary creations. These folded or rolled tortillas stuffed with various fillings like grilled meats, vegetables, and salsa are a must-try. Don’t forget to squeeze a lime over your tacos for that extra zing!
Enchiladas
Enchiladas are corn tortillas rolled around a filling and covered with a chili pepper sauce. They’re typically filled with cheese, meat, beans, or a combination of these. Topped with cheese and sometimes sour cream, these savory delights are baked to perfection.
Guacamole
Guacamole, made from mashed avocados mixed with lime juice and seasonings, is a beloved Mexican condiment. It’s often served with tortilla chips and makes for a refreshing snack or appetizer.
Tamales
Tamales are a labor of love. These are masa (dough) filled with various ingredients, such as meat, cheese, or vegetables, and wrapped in corn husks. They’re then steamed to perfection, resulting in a moist and flavorful dish.
Modern Mexican Delights
While traditional Mexican cuisine holds a special place in the hearts of many, modern Mexican chefs are pushing boundaries and creating innovative dishes that fuse tradition with contemporary flair. Here are some dishes that showcase the evolution of Mexican cuisine:
Tacos Al Pastor
These tacos are a perfect example of Mexican fusion cuisine. They feature marinated, spit-roasted pork that draws inspiration from Middle Eastern shawarma, combined with Mexican flavors like pineapple and cilantro.
Chiles Rellenos
Chiles rellenos traditionally consist of stuffed, battered, and fried chili peppers. Modern variations can include everything from seafood to exotic cheeses, adding exciting twists to this classic dish.
Mexican Street Corn (Elote)
Elote is a popular Mexican street food featuring grilled corn on the cob slathered with mayonnaise, cotija cheese, chili powder, and lime juice. It’s a delicious combination of creamy, salty, spicy, and tangy flavors.
